    I never liked people playing deep sea aria. It's a brick if you draw multiple, requires setup so it's not truly a one card starter, and it has limitations to what it searches. I've always run a small world package for my Atlantean Mermail deck, having spooky dogwood and gaemeciel in the main give you bridges to your entire deck, and they are also good going second cards anyway. You can also get to one of them too, so if your hand is like prince + extenders + small world on top then you simply search for a dogwood at the end of your combo and now you've got a free handtrap, something that aria can't do. The icejades being aquas also give you bridges as well, so it's not like drawing the kaiju is even bad, and if you run the one of Mermail pike for the normal combo it's also a valid bridge since it's a level 4 fish. Just food for thought, I've always run small world and personally think it's the far superior option to aria as it gives you access to not only your starters but also your extenders such as abyssteus

      Hey man, the comment here! Ur 100% right about aria not being a true 1 card starter. Aria is basically a worse dargoons because it requires a waybto trigger it and with it not being a water, it then requires even further set up. Luckily the white aura engine helps with this cus simply opening sardine or the spell tht searches it gets aria online without spending any resources. This being said, small world is stronger as in it doesn't really care about wht other cards u open as u open a monster, ur almost garenteed ur desired search target. I guess wht really keeps off of small world is having to sack a card in hand so while ur getting the card u want, it's still a -1. Doesn't mean it's a bad card but is important to take note of. I need to test with small world, take it to a locals, and see how it does for me to have a more concrete opinion on it
